Hypocalcemic coma following two pediatric phosphate enemas

Summary
Pediatric hypertonic phosphate enemas can cause severe, life-threatening complications like coma and tetany due to electrolyte imbalances. This case highlights the critical need for awareness of these risks in routine medical practice.
Area of Science:
- Pediatric Gastroenterology
- Clinical Toxicology
Background:
- Hypertonic phosphate enemas are commonly used in pediatric practice for constipation.
- Potential risks associated with enema administration are not always fully appreciated.
Observation:
- A 2 1/2-year-old girl developed severe systemic toxicity after receiving two hypertonic phosphate enemas.
- Clinical manifestations included coma, tetany, dehydration, hypotension, tachycardia, and hyperpyrexia.
Findings:
- Laboratory analysis revealed marked hyperphosphatemia, hypocalcemia, hypernatremia, and acidosis.
- The observed clinical symptoms are consistent with severe electrolyte disturbances, particularly hypocalcemia secondary to hyperphosphatemia.
- Calculations suggest significant absorption of both phosphorus and sodium from the enema solution.
Implications:
- This case underscores the potentially lethal complications of hypertonic phosphate enemas in children.
- Healthcare providers must exercise caution and be aware of the risks associated with this seemingly routine procedure.
- Alternative, safer methods for managing constipation in pediatric patients should be considered.
